From outgoing director to incoming, re: the Mosswick Bakehouse franchise agreement. Status: signed, five-unit commitment across the Dunharrow region, royalties at standard tier, first fee installment received. Outstanding: fit-out cost reconciliation for the Larkfield site and the disputed training levy. Escrow releases on opening certification. Watch the quarterly minimums — franchisee cash flow is thin. All working files are in the shared ledger folder. Context on where we intend to take the franchise program appears below.

board note of yajeg-yaweg: The pricing group signed off on a budget of $4.9 million for Project Quenix. The renewal with Sormirek Freight closes at $6.1 million a year, 37 percent below the last contract.

Meeting notes — Pipewatch webhook delivery. Agreed: exponential backoff, max 6 attempts, 24h cutoff. Duplicate deliveries acceptable; consumers must be idempotent. Dead-letter queue drains weekly. 5xx retried, 4xx dropped and logged. Release blocked until retry metrics dashboard ships. Decision authority for any changes to these semantics rests with the person named below.

named custodian: Zorok Briir Novvan

Quick note for the sync: the Bouncewright processor now exposes a /suppressions endpoint so downstream teams can query hard bounces directly instead of parsing the digest. Rate limits are generous (600/min), and responses are paginated. Auth is the usual header-based scheme against the internal gateway. For staging experiments this week, use the shared key below.

app token of hahaf-bafop = qvz3-arh

## Configuration

Quick notes for the eng sync: the Fernhollow CSV import wizard now validates headers before upload instead of after, so malformed files fail fast and nobody waits ten minutes to find out column three is cursed. Mapping presets live in config, delimiter sniffing is on by default, and you can cap row counts per tenant. One gotcha: the wizard calls the dedupe service on every run, and that call is authenticated. Drop the following line into your env file so the dedupe call works.

env line for yahag-kajog: VAULT_KEY13=e1c568d90102d